This six-day residential retreat offers the opportunity for you to experience the teachings of the Buddha using the body as a gateway for insight and freedom.
The retreat will guide you in cultivating embodied self-awareness, rediscovering the organic rhythm of your being as a source of clarity and profound freedom. Connecting and trusting your inner rhythm becomes a foundation, empowering you to face life’s challenges with intimacy, balance and ease.
The program will consist of various practices.  At the core will be Insight Meditation practices which include guided meditation, walking meditation and talks reflecting the teachings of the Buddha.
These will be supported by somatic practices (the Greek word soma means the body). These practices are designed to deepen the connection between body and mind as a way to support awakening, concentration and ease of body-mind-heart.
We will also be offering Mindful Movement sessions. These sessions are adapted from Biodanza, a profound methodology that supports learning to dance with life and rediscovering our vitality and the pleasure of living.
